Package io.milvus.bulkwriter.storage
Interface StorageClient
-
- All Known Implementing Classes:
AzureStorageClient
,MinioStorageClient
public interface StorageClient
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description boolean
checkBucketExist(java.lang.String bucketName)
java.lang.Long
getObjectEntity(java.lang.String bucketName, java.lang.String objectKey)
void
putObjectStream(java.io.InputStream inputStream, long contentLength, java.lang.String bucketName, java.lang.String objectKey)
-
-
-
Method Detail
-
getObjectEntity
java.lang.Long getObjectEntity(java.lang.String bucketName, java.lang.String objectKey) throws java.lang.Exception
- Throws:
java.lang.Exception
-
checkBucketExist
boolean checkBucketExist(java.lang.String bucketName) throws java.lang.Exception
- Throws:
java.lang.Exception
-
putObjectStream
void putObjectStream(java.io.InputStream inputStream, long contentLength, java.lang.String bucketName, java.lang.String objectKey) throws java.lang.Exception
- Throws:
java.lang.Exception
-
-